Mercedes said it expects the Maybach EQS SUV to post a range of 373 miles (600 km) on the optimistic European WLTP test cycle. In the US, the non-Maybach EQS SUV has a range of just over 300 miles.

The Maybach EQS SUV will be the first electric SUV from an ultra-luxury brand. The Rolls-Royce Spectre is a more traditional coupe, and Bentley doesn’t plan to launch its first EV until 2025.
